Summary of major redistricting recommendations
High schools
New Winchester Road school
■ Students will be drawn primarily from Bryan Station and Henry Clay high schools. Attendance area generally bounded by Interstate 64 and Eastland Parkway on the north, Liberty Road and Todds Road on the south, downtown's East End neighborhood and Clark County line.
